Elected City Councillor for the Green Party for St David's ward in 2022 I was proud to represent the residents of Exeter for four rewarding, often challenging, sometimes frustrating but always highly worthwhile years. In this time I reopened the archway in the Roman city wall between Rougemont and Northernway Gardens, helped the farmers market at the quayside be set up, got policies on what we can do locally to address the climate and nature crisis be put in place, rehoused the street attached, helped hundreds of residents with damp and mould and parking tickets and missed bins, spoke up in Council on countless concerns, attended hundreds of meetings, answered thousands of emails, sang in Council making the news on three occasions, and was appointed Exeter's first Green Deputy Lord Mayor of Exeter.
